Caldillo de Chile Verde Recipe

Prep Time: 20 mins | Cook Time: 2 hours | Total Time: 2 hrs 20 mins
Servings: 4-6

Ingredients

  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• 1.5 lbs beef stew meat, cubed
  • Salt & pepper, to taste
  • 1 large onion, chopped
  • 3 garlic cloves, minced
  • 1 lb tomatillos, husked & chopped
  • 3-4 green chiles (poblano or Anaheim), roasted & chopped
  • 1 jalapeño, seeded & chopped (optional for heat)
  • 4 cups beef broth
  • 1 tsp ground cumin
  • ½ tsp dried oregano
  • Fresh cilantro & lime wedges, for serving

Instructions

  1. Brown the Beef: Heat oil in a large pot over medium-high. Season beef with salt and pepper, then brown in batches. Set aside.
  2. Sauté Veggies: In the same pot, cook onion until soft (~5 mins). Add garlic and cook 1 minute until fragrant.
  3. Add Chiles & Tomatillos: Stir in tomatillos, roasted chiles, and jalapeño (if using). Cook 5-7 mins until tomatillos soften.
  4. Simmer: Return beef to the pot. Add broth, cumin, and oregano.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er 1.5-2 hours until beef is fork-tender.
  5. Serve: Adjust seasoning, then ladle into bowls. Garnish with cilantro and a squeeze of lime!

Pro Tips

  • For extra depth, char the tomatillos and chiles under the broiler before chopping.
  • Short on time? Use an Instant Pot (30 mins on high pressure).
  • Make it mild by omitting the jalapeño or using bell peppers.

Serving Suggestions

  • With warm flour tortillas for dipping.
  • Over cilantro-lime rice for a fuller meal.
  • Topped with avocado or queso fresco.
